Four-time Pro Bowl RB Ahman Green worked out for St. Louis this week as the team examines its options at the position.
The Rams have Steven Jackson, a 2007 Pro Bowler, as their starting running back, with Kenneth Darby, Samkon Gado and Antonio Pittman as the experienced backups behind him.
Green, who endured two injury-plagued seasons with the Texans, is one of several high-profile running backs still on the market, including Edgerrin James, Shaun Alexander and Warrick Dunn. All have had a tough time finding work this offseason, although NFL.com’s Steve Wyche reports that Dunn received calls from the Eagles and Seahawks.
Green was a powerhouse player for the Packers from 2000 to 2006, but he hasn’t had more than 300 yards in a season since 2006, which was his last 1,000-yard campaign.
Green has 9,045 rushing yards in 11 seasons with the Seahawks, Packers and Texans. He also has six 1,000-yard seasons in his career.
